Anaconda is a good climber and can live without food for almost a year after feeding on a big prey. Grassland animals have adapted to dry and windy climate conditions. The constant warmth and humidity of tropical rain forests provide an ideal habitat where snakes can live without having to shelter from heat or cold. The warm, wet climate encourages lots of large green plants to grow.
